Bezos Scholars Program

Listen up, Juniors!  This Leadership/Scholarship program is just for you!  The Bezos Scholars Program is a year-long leadership program that amplifies youth voice and action.  Accepted scholars are invited to attend an all-expenses paid trip to the Aspen Ideas Festival during the summer after Junior Year.  During your senior year, scholars receive ongoing mentorship, leadership development, and $1,000 to launch their own community change project.
